The aims of Scientology are "A civilization without madness, without offenders and without war, where the able can flourish and truthful beings can have legal rights, and where male is free to rise to higher heights".
Below are a few of the standard facets of what Scientologists believe: Scientology was developed by L. Ron Hubbard (1911 to 1986) in 1952 and was formally included as The Church of Scientology in 1953 in Camden, New Jersey. The faith essentially focuses around the idea that all individuals are never-ceasing beings, who have actually fallen to neglect their real nature.

One of the core points Scientologists believe is that every little thing we each experience in this life, and also previous lives, are taped as "engrams" on our minds.
A power or pressure called "Theta" which transcends all things is promoted by the sect. Unlike Christianity there is no specific mentors of God in Scientology, however participants are welcome to be "emotionally informed" to a divine being as they advance in the confidence - Scientology. There are different levels of enlightenment in Scientology; Pre-Clear, Clear, and Operating Thetan, with the last degree of Running Thetan being someone who has the ability to regulate matter, energy, time, and thought
They believe that can not free themselves without helping to totally free others at the very same time, so leaders or "Auditors" are used to try and assist others determine their previous life and existing life disruptions, so they can work with dropping them and relocate to an extra enlightened degree.

This creed elaborates on and matches the Scientology teaching on the Eight Characteristics. A "dynamic" is an impulse, drive or impulse to YOURURL.com survival at the levels of the self, sex (consisting of procreation as a family), group, all of the human race, all living points, all the physical universe, spirit, and, ultimately, Infinity or God.
